A kid‑friendly ebook that explains what makes grasshoppers special: they are insects with six legs, two antennae, three body parts, two pairs of wings, and long hind legs that act like built‑in pogo sticks for jumping far distances. Children discover that grasshoppers live on almost every continent except the cold polar regions, usually in grassy areas where they eat plants such as grasses, leaves, stems, flowers, and crop plants. The ebook introduces simple ideas such as “herbivore,” “camouflage,” and “incomplete metamorphosis,” and shows how grasshoppers blend into green and brown backgrounds, chirp or “sing” by rubbing wings or legs, and grow from eggs to wingless nymphs to fully winged adults through several molts. A colorful infographic poster that visually presents the most important facts about grasshoppers: body parts, sizes, habitats, diet, and life cycle. The poster uses diagrams and short captions to help children quickly remember that grasshoppers can jump many times their own body length, that most species are medium‑sized insects between about 1 and 7 cm long, and that females are often larger and lay eggs in pods in the soil. It highlights fun facts such as how male grasshoppers “sing” to attract mates, how some species can migrate in large groups, how many eggs a female can lay, and how young nymphs look like mini adults but without wings, turning complex information into a simple, memorable visual guide to grasshopper biology.
